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
Referring to fig. 1-3, the present invention provides a technical solution: a test tube rack comprises a support column 1, wherein a base 2 is fixedly installed at the bottom end of the support column 1, a plurality of support rods 3 are fixedly installed at the top of the support column 1, an installation plate 4 is fixedly installed at one end of each support rod 3, a test tube hole 5 is formed in the surface of the installation plate 4 in a penetrating mode, a fixing mechanism 6 is installed inside the test tube hole 5, a tray 7 is installed on the surface of the support column 1 corresponding to the bottom of the installation plate 4, and a groove 8 is formed in the surface of the tray 7 corresponding to the test tube hole 5;
the fixing mechanism 6 comprises a stroke hole 61, a fixing block 62, a spring 63, a limiting groove 64 and a sliding block 65, wherein the stroke hole 61 is formed in the inner wall of the test tube hole 5.
In this embodiment: spring 63's one end fixed connection is inside stroke hole 61, spring 63's other end fixedly connected with fixed block 62, the both sides fixedly connected with slider 65 of fixed block 62, and spacing groove 64 is seted up in the inner wall both sides of stroke hole 61, and slider 65 sliding connection is inside spacing groove 64, and fixed block 62 extends to inside the test tube hole 5.
When in specific use: when the test tube was placed in test tube hole 5 inside, because the variation in size of test tube makes the test tube contact test tube hole 5 inside fixed block 62 after extrusion fixed block 62, fixed block 62 receives the slider 65 that both sides are connected spacing, make fixed block 62 move to stroke hole 61 inside along spacing groove 64, fixed block 62 extrusion makes spring 63 compression hold up power this moment, fixed block 62 receives spring 63 reaction force to press from both sides tight the test tube, make the stable placing in test tube hole 5 of test tube, avoid the test tube because of unmatched the emergence with test tube hole 5 and rock, the displacement of fixed block 62 is adjusted and has satisfied placing of different diameter test tubes simultaneously.
In this embodiment: spout 9 has been seted up all around on the surface of support column 1, one side fixedly connected with adjusting bolt 10 of tray 7, and adjusting bolt 10's one end sliding connection is inside spout 9, and adjusting bolt 10's surperficial threaded connection has fixation nut 11, the inside fixedly connected with sponge piece of recess 8.
When in specific use: spout 9 has been seted up all around on 1 surface of support column, adjusting bolt 10 that tray 7 one side is connected slides inside spout 9, make through adjusting tray 7 in the position on 1 surface of support column be close to or keep away from with mounting panel 4, satisfy the support to the test tube bottom after different length test tubes are placed for the test tube bottom is placed in recess 8 that tray 7 surface was seted up, recess 8 internal connection has the sponge piece, plays the effect of protection test tube.
In this embodiment: an identification fence 12 is fixedly installed on one side of the outer wall of the installation plate 4, and the identification fence 12 is transparent.
When in specific use: the sign fence 12 of 4 outer wall installations of mounting panel adopts acrylic transparent material, conveniently observes the test tube of taking after different test tube label paper are put into sign fence 12 insides.
In this embodiment: a drawer box 13 is fixedly arranged at the bottom of the tray 7, and a handle 14 is arranged on the surface of the drawer box 13.
When in specific use: the drawer box 13 is pulled out from the bottom of the tray 7 by pulling the handle 14, and the drawer box 13 arranged at the bottom of the tray 7 is used for placing some experimental articles, so that the articles can be placed and taken conveniently during experimental operation.
